Wimbledon roof closure not a factor in Grigor Dimitrov’s injury, says coach

  • Grigor Dimitrov retired from his Wimbledon fourth-round match against Jannik Sinner due to a pectoral injury, despite leading by two sets to love.
  • The retirement marked Dimitrov's fifth consecutive withdrawal from a Grand Slam match.
  • Speculation arose that the timing of the Centre Court roof closure between sets might have contributed to Dimitrov's injury.
  • Dimitrov's coach, Jamie Delgado, dismissed this theory, stating Dimitrov felt warmer and looser after the roof closed.
  • Delgado expressed the team's profound disappointment and the emotional difficulty for Dimitrov, saying he anticipated several weeks of recovery.
